B.
Emergency work may be undertaken without first obtaining a permit, and a permit must be obtained on the next day the office is open following commencement of such work.
C.
Fees for permits and inspections under this article shall be as set forth in the permit fee schedule adopted by the City Council.
D.
For permit fees based on the cost of work or square feet of the area of the work, whichever has a greater value, after calculation. If the proposed project cost submitted by the applicant is less than that as would be indicated by national standards, the City of Sanford reserves the right to determine the proposed project cost based on those standards and assess the permit fee accordingly.
E.
Except for emergency work, the fee for any permit obtained after work has been commenced shall be double the fee otherwise provided for in the fee schedule pursuant to this section.
F.
The Code Enforcement Director shall adopt a policy authorizing refunds of any fee under this section, where appropriate.
